I saw this and really liked it. But I agree with most of the good and bad parts you are all saying.
I loved the opening, felt very Indiana Jonesy with the running from the tribe.
The movie had a ton of good laughs. Like Kirk asking Uhura about fighting with Spock. "What is that even like?!"
And Urban's performance of McCoy continuously brings the awesome. "Captain Sulu. Remind me to never piss you off." Just so many good one liners from him.
When Kirk and Khan were shot to the other space ship was so awesome. I don't think I'll ever get tired of seeing those space dives.
Anyways that's just my small take from the film, excluding it's political themes and whatnot. I took away from it what I wanted to, I wont change any others opinions, I just want to touch on the stuff that was really good in it.
I just want more of the movies to be honest. Next one needs to just be the crew in space getting into some situation. Nothing from back home. But I guess that would be obvious with the 5 year mission laid out.'
oh edit: Did not really dig the whole asking Old Spock who is Khan. I mean, are they going to do this everytime something happens? Love Nimoy and all, but it felt like a cheap pop.
